Comment faire du clean code ?

Le clean code est une approche que tout bon programmeur se doit d’adopter. Non seulement il permet de lire plus facilement un code, mais il facilite aussi sa compréhension, sa maintenance ou son amélioration. Voici quelques points essentiels à retenir pour obtenir un clean code.

Limitez les imbrications

Les imbrications font partie des éléments pouvant compliquer la lecture et l’exploitation d’un code. En effet, si vous avez, par exemple, un tableau contenant un tableau qui contient lui-même un autre tableau, il sera difficile d’extraire proprement le contenu de ce dernier. Il en est de même pour les boucles qui contiennent des boucles. Pour éviter les imbrications, la création de fonctions indépendantes est souvent la meilleure solution. Les fonctions indépendantes vous permettent également de limiter la répétition de code.

Si vous voulez booster un peu vos connaissances IT, suivez une formation en clean code sur une plateforme de e-learning et e-coaching nouvelle génération. Cette approche vous permettra de gagner du temps et de maîtriser vos budgets de formation.

Utilisez des mots cohérents et compréhensibles

Lorsque vous êtes pressé, vous êtes tenté d’utiliser des noms simples pour vos fonctions et vos variables. Toutefois, ces nomenclatures simples peuvent se répéter et vous risquez de ne plus vous y retrouver. Afin de garder votre code propre et ne pas vous perdre, choisissez des noms simples, faciles à comprendre et de préférence, en respectant le concept de Pascal Case ou de Camel Case. Évitez également les noms de variables à une lettre et lorsqu’il s’agit d’une constante, écrivez-la en majuscule. Sachez que même pour un développeur-programmeur francophone, utiliser des mots en anglais est parfois plus simple puisque ceux-ci sont souvent plus courts.

Utilisez les commentaires avec soin

Si votre code est destiné à être exploité par d’autres utilisateurs alors, les commentaires doivent être présents. En plus d’aider à sectionner votre code, ces commentaires permettront de comprendre l’intérêt ou le fonctionnement de chaque section. Malgré tout, n’en abusez pas, car cela risque de compliquer la lecture du code si les commentaires sont présents à chaque ligne. Avec un code bien écrit et facile à comprendre, le besoin de commenter est parfois réduit.

Please Post Your Comments & Reviews

Votre adresse e-mail ne sera pas publiée. Les champs obligatoires sont indiqués avec *